Nova Scotia Department of Natural Resources completes H125 fleet renewal

Airbus Helicopters has delivered the fourth and final H125 to the Nova Scotia Department of Natural Resources (NSDNR), completing the province’s fleet renewal programme. Ordered in 2024, the four new helicopters replace a fleet that entered service in 2016. U.S. Customs orders ten Airbus H125 helicopters

U.S. Customs and Border Protection Air and Marine Operations (CBP AMO) has ordered ten Airbus H125 helicopters to strengthen its airborne law enforcement, border security and public safety capabilities across the United States. H125 gains FAA certification for single pilot IFR capability

The H125’s single pilot instrument flight rules (IFR) capability has been certified by the U.S.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), paving the way for first deliveries in 2025 from Airbus Helicopters‘ assembly line in Columbus, Mississippi. Nova Scotia renews helicopter fleet with Airbus H125 order

The government of Nova Scotia has placed an order for four Airbus H125 helicopters as part of a complete fleet renewal for the Department of Natural Resources and Renewables.
